Returning: Refers to a woman getting married. 'Gui' means' return '. In ancient times, it was believed that a woman's husband's family was her ultimate destination, and marrying into her husband's family was the true meaning of returning home;

Guining: also known as Huimen, refers to a married woman returning to her parents' home to visit them. Newlywed couples usually bring gifts to visit the bride's home on the third day of their wedding.

What are the requirements for Guining

1. Time

In ancient times, the time for returning home was usually on the 3rd, 6th, 7th, 8th, and 9th day after marriage. Nowadays, the groom usually accompanies the bride to visit her parents and relatives on the third day after marriage.

2. Clothing

The best attire for returning home is new clothes, with festive colors as the main color. Red cheongsams, coats, and DRESSes are more favored by brides. Remember not to wear cold colored clothes such as black or gray when returning home.

3. Etiquette and Etiquette

When returning home, you cannot go empty handed. You should bring gifts such as tobacco, alcohol, tea, local specialties, red envelopes, etc. to show your appreciation for the bride's family. The quantity should be even, symbolizing that good things come in pairs.

4. Banquet

Most families will hold a homecoming banquet on the day their daughters return home, inviting some relatives and friends who did not attend the wedding. At the banquet, the bride should accompany the groom to toast their parents, relatives, and friends one by one, thanking the guests for their blessings.
